Vanguard University of Southern California vs. California Miramar

Both Vanguard University of Southern California and California Miramar University are 4 years schools located in California. The following statements compare Vanguard University of Southern California and California Miramar University with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are private.
  • Vanguard University of Southern California's tuition ($39,950) is more expensive than California Miramar ($9,994).
  • Vanguard University of Southern California's acceptance rate (64.70%) is lower than California Miramar (65.52%).
  • California Miramar has higher yield (57.89%) than Vanguard University of Southern California (22.67%).
  • Vanguard University of Southern California's students to faculty ratio (16 to 1) is lower than California Miramar (17 to 1).
  • Vanguard University of Southern California (2,219 students) is larger than California Miramar (222 students) with more enrolled students.
  • Vanguard University of Southern California ($26,454) has higher amount of financial aid than California Miramar ($5,731).
  • Both schools have same graduation rate of 56%.
